Psychology: Linn Dara Inpatient Unit

You are likely to meet with the clinical psychologist while in the Linn Dara Inpatient Unit. The psychologist will work with you and your family with the goal of improving your distress and mental health problems. They might also work with you in a group with other young people. The clinical psychologist will assess your individual situation and with you, try to better understand your thoughts, feelings and behaviours. They usually ask about important times from your past and about key relationships in your life. They pull the information together to help you to get a clearer picture of what might be causing and maintaining your problems.

Clinical psychologists use research to learn the best ways to treat young people who have difficulties like you. This often involves supporting you to understand yourself better and to learn new ways of coping with problems. Sometimes young people have concerns about their learning and concentration, the psychologist can also help you to understand these better.
